Trade your expectations for appreciation and your whole world changes in an instant - Tony Robbins
At its core, this quote is about a fundamental swap. You're replacing the heavy, often disappointing weight of how you think things *should* be with the light, empowering practice of valuing things *as they are*.

Anger is not wrong; it’s a sign of a need calling for understanding - Marshall B. Rosenberg
At its core, this quote tells us that anger itself is a neutral, valid emotion. It's not a moral failing. It's actually a powerful alarm bell, an indicator light on your dashboard, signaling that a deep, fundamental human need is feeling starved or threatened.
